Lake Land College class registration begins

Posted on March 24, 2020

As Lake Land College moves forward in a virtual environment, 2020 Summer and Fall registration will open March 25 as planned. For the first time in the college’s history, registration will be open to all students who are cleared to register versus a tiered approach in which sophomores were given priority the first day of registration.

“We want to open registration to all who have been proactive and received clearance, as well as readmit and new non-degree seeking students who are ready to register,”  Jon Van Dyke, dean of admission services, said.

“We know our current students have been transitioning to a new online environment this week, and we want to be as supportive and helpful as possible,” Van Dyke added.

Current students can login to the Laker Hub and view their Advisement Information page for important information on the advisement process. In the virtual environment, students can connect with their advisors through Laker Mail or via phone. Current degree-seeking students must receive clearance before registering.
